Abstract: | In this paper, delafossite-type Na0.5Li0.5CoO2 nanoparticles (NPs) with an average particle size of 50 nm were successfully synthesized by sol–gel method. Prepared NPs were characterized by differential thermal analysis, powder X-ray diffraction, transmission electron microscopy, scanning electron microscopy, and scanning tunneling microscopy. The nanoparticles showed the excellent adsorption properties towards methylene blue dye (MBD) as a reactive dye. The kinetics of removal of MBD in aqueous solutions was studied in a series of experiments which were varied in the amount of NPs, contact time, pH, and temperature. The experimental data were fitted very well in the pseudo-second order kinetic model and the Freundlich adsorption isotherm model. 92% of dye was successfully removed in 10 min using 0.02 g Na0.5Li0.5CoO2 NPs in a pH = 11. Thermodynamic study indicates that the adsorption of MBD is feasible, and spontaneous in nature. |
